OTA(Over-The-Air)是指通过无线网络更新设备软件的一种技术。OTA方案的实现可以提高设备的可靠性和安全性,同时也可以降低企业运营成本。

以下是一个OTA相关的方案:

  1. 设计OTA服务器:OTA服务器需要支持设备固件的存储和管理,可以根据设备型号和版本号来区分不同的固件。OTA服务器还需要支持升级包的生成和管理,以及与设备的通信协议。

  2. 设计设备端OTA升级程序:设备端OTA升级程序需要支持与OTA服务器的通信,并且能够验证升级包的完整性和正确性。如果升级包验证失败,设备应该能够自动回滚到之前的版本。

  3. 部署OTA服务器:OTA服务器应该部署在安全可靠的环境中,以确保设备升级的安全性和可靠性。同时,OTA服务器需要实现负载均衡和故障转移,以保证服务的可用性。

  4. 测试OTA方案:在实际使用OTA方案之前,需要对OTA服务器和设备端OTA升级程序进行测试,以确保升级的可靠性和安全性。

  5. 实施OTA升级:当需要对设备进行升级时,OTA服务器会向设备发送升级通知,设备端OTA升级程序会下载升级包并进行验证。如果升级包验证通过,设备会自动升级到新版本的固件。

  6. 监控OTA升级:OTA升级完成后,需要对设备进行监控以确保设备的正常运行。如果出现问题,应该能够及时发现并解决。

以上是一个OTA相关的方案,可以根据实际情况进行具体的实施。

OTA方案设计与实施:提升设备可靠性和安全性

原文地址: https://www.cveoy.top/t/topic/lNjH 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录